What is IPsec protocol


IPsec is a structure in which expands IP packet header it uses extra protocol numbers instead of options for the security which operates the network layer. It can also be defined as the framework which works on the protocol set for the security at the network. It is an end-to-end security plan to operate the layer of the internet protocol suite. It is not just limited to the certain applications it is compatible with any network whether it is limited like LAN or across the globe.

Modes of IPsec Protocol:
In IPsec there are two choices in security. And there are two modes of operation.


Tunnel mode:
In this mode the whole packet is certified and a new packet is used with a new header rather than the old one. Basically this mode is used to make virtual private network when using a network-to-network communication like it happens in link sites and routers. It is also used in private chat technically known as host-to-host communication and host-to-network.


Transport mode:
This mode is generally used in, for the communications between host to host. In this mode routing is entire because of unmodified and unscripted header usage but if the authenticated header is used then one can not translate the IP address of the computer because of unapproved hash value. Hash secures the traffic and layers of application so they can not be upgraded like it is not possible to translate port numbers. If here is host-to-host connection then it is used to protect the flow of data as well as in network to network and network to host connections.

 

Advantages:

  1. Internet protocol security provides privacy, makes it more authentic and anti-replay protection for network traffic.
  2. In client-to-client server it provides complete security
  3. In IPsec transport mode it provides complete security in server-to server and client-to-client.
  4. In wide area network (WAN) and the connections based on internet it provides full privacy.
  5. It can be used in all sizes networks like LAN (local area network) and global networks.
  6. Things like applications, protocols which carry low level data, users and transporting technology performance does not effect because it works on low level of network.

Disadvantages:
                   Though it is very useful and it has revolutionized the sector still it has some disadvantages.

  • Most of the operating system kernels do not allow direct manipulation of IP headers hence it requires operating system support.
  • It is very complex because it has lots of options and features which opens the gates of the chances of a hole and a shortcoming.
  • If there are great replay attacks then IPsec becomes weak against it.
  • If the firewall is not used along the IPsec it creates problem because it burns the role of firewall.
